    Hi Everyone,
    I was wondering what people thought on this issue.

    I have an Ocellaris Clown Fish (less than a year old) in a small 29 gal tank. I am upgrading to a new 54 gal tank. I was hoping that in this new tank I would be able to have clown fish, anemonae, and possibly have my clown fish breed. I really like yellow stripe maroon clowns, so I wanted to breed these.

    Is it possible that since technically this is a new tank I will be starting, if I add a mated pair of YS Maroon Clowns and my old Ocellaris clown, that they all would get along since they all would be new to the tank, hence not be so territorial?

    I know that some times things don't always go as planned (such as if they host or not), but maybe this would be a big no-no.

    Is mixing these species okay? Is it best to just keep one type of clown in one tank?
